In unseasonably warm weather, Jeju records new hourly power peakOn June 11, hourly peak topped 501,100kw as Korea Power Exchange and provincial officials encourage conservation

A dramatic increase in the use of electricity on Jeju in the last few days is pointing to further difficulties with the supply coming this summer. Abnormally high temperatures and a reduction in supply from the national grid are the main factors, according to a recent statement from officials for Jeju Special Self-Governing Province and the Korea Power Exchange, Jeju office, on June 12.

On June 11, an hourly peak of 501,100kw was recorded on Jeju, an increase of 30,000kw from a year ago. Demand peaks at around 9 p.m., mainly from air conditioner use. Recent temperatures on the island have hit the high-20s during the day.

The Korea Power Exchange said it expects hourly peak demand will reach 681,000kw by late July or early August. The national electric power allotment has been reduced by 3,500,000kw per hour, which is likely to affect Jeju’s power supply in the coming weeks and months.

To combat this problem, the provincial government is planning to encourage businesses to set their thermometers to 26 degrees Celsius and to avoid air conditioning during peak hours. Businesses that are found to be using air conditioners with their front doors open will be fined.

The Jeju Special Self-Governing Province and the Korea Power Exchange, Jeju office said that the island currently has a stable level of reserved electric supply at 34 percent, but conservation will be key to maintaining this margin during the rest of the summer.
